Various forms of hydraulic oil are available, every tailor-made to particular applications and working circumstances:
- Mineral Oil: Traditional hydraulic oil derived from petroleum, suitable for general-purpose hydraulic methods working underneath moderate conditions.
- Synthetic Oil: Formulated from artificial base shares, artificial hydraulic oil provides superior performance in extreme temperatures, high-pressure situations, and demanding applications.
- Biodegradable Oil: Environmentally friendly hydraulic oil made from renewable sources, biodegradable hydraulic oil is appropriate for environmentally delicate areas and functions requiring eco-friendly fluids.
- Fire-Resistant Oil: Specialized hydraulic oil with fire-resistant properties, fire-resistant hydraulic oil reduces the chance of fireplace and enhances security in purposes where fire hazards are a priority.

The remanufacturing course of for cylinder heads sometimes involves the next steps:
1. Cleaning and Inspection: Cylinder heads are completely cleaned to take away dust, grease, and old gasket material. They are then inspected for cracks, warping, and different harm.
2. Machining: If necessary, cylinder heads undergo machining processes similar to milling, grinding, and honing to revive flatness, smoothness, and dimensional accuracy.
three. Valve Replacement: Worn or damaged valves, guides, and seals are changed with new components to make sure proper sealing and valve operation.
four. Pressure Testing: Cylinder heads are stress tested to confirm their integrity and ensure they will face up to the pressures and temperatures encountered during engine operation.
5. Assembly: Once all components have been refurbished or replaced, the cylinder heads are reassembled with new gaskets and seals, ready for set up onto the engine block.

In the realm of hydraulic fittings, several types are widely used:
- Straight Fittings: Connect two hoses or tubes in a straight line.
- Elbow Fittings: Allow for directional changes, typically at ninety or 45-degree angles.
- Tee Fittings: Branch off a hydraulic line into two separate paths.
- Adapter Fittings: Enable connections between differing kinds or sizes of hydraulic elements.
- Quick Disconnect Fittings: Facilitate fast and tool-free connections and disconnections for straightforward maintenance and repair.

2. What supplies are hydraulic fittings made of?
Hydraulic fittings are commonly made from supplies similar to steel, stainless-steel, brass, and aluminum, chosen for their strength, corrosion resistance, and compatibility with hydraulic fluids.
